Copper Aluminum Bimetal Sheets: The Marriage of Metal Marvels In the world of industrial materials, innovation often comes from combining the strengths of different elements. Copper Aluminum Bimetal Sheets are a prime example of this, offering a powerful solution for various applications. Let's delve into what makes these bimetal sheets so special. What are Copper Aluminum Bimetal Sheets? Imagine a sheet that merges the exceptional electrical conductivity of copper with the lightness and corrosion resistance of aluminum. That's the magic of Copper Aluminum Bimetal Sheets. Through a special roll bonding process, these sheets become a unified material, offering the best of both worlds for industrial needs. How are these Bimetal Sheets Made? The secret lies in the roll bonding process. This technique essentially pressure bonds copper sheet metal to a base layer of pure aluminum. Without relying on alloys or electroplating, this creates an inseparable and robust connection, ensuring long-lasting performance. Beyond Safety: Applications for High-Voltage Needs The impressive properties of Copper Aluminum Bimetal Sheets make them suitable for high-voltage applications. Their unique construction prevents a phenomenon called bimetallic galvanic corrosion, which occurs when dissimilar metals come into contact. This makes them ideal for safely connecting different metals within electrical systems, even under high voltage.
